Eaton has introduced Procision, a new line of medium-duty dual-clutch transmissions, that delivers 8 to 10 percent better fuel economy than a similarly equipped vehicle with a torque converter automatic. These features can be disabled for even greater fuel economy if desired.

Eaton hybrid electric power systems employ parallel-type diesel-electric hybrid architecture that incorporates a 44 kW peak / 26 kW continuous electric motor/generator between the output of an automated clutch and input of the transmission. Eaton has launched a new family of UltraShift PLUS transmissions designed exclusively for Navistar to maximize fuel efficiency in linehaul applications. Fleets involved with testing the new transmissions have reported fuel economy improvements from 2-4% percent. Production is scheduled to take place in April of this year.

Eaton says it has shown in regulatory test cycles and real-world use that its cylinder-deactivation (CDA) technology can play a key role in helping commercial vehicle manufacturers meet or exceed 2024 and 2027 US emissions regulations. The combination of Eaton CDA and improved aftertreatment met the expected NO x requirement for 2027.

Eaton has announced its newest supercharger—TVS2—which improves vehicle manufacturers’ ability to deliver an optimal single boosted application, or to pair this device with other boosting technologies in order to deliver compound boosting solutions for improved engine performance—a combined supercharger-turbocharger system.

A supercharger with a magnetic clutch compensates for the disadvantage of the small displacement engine with the Miller cycle without sacrificing fuel economy. Because the new engine has a supercharging system, the intake port could be designed for tumble flow specifically, allocating the air charging function on the supercharger.
